Chinese painting incorporated with poems is famous for its distinct characteristics and unspeakable moods. Ink lines are used to depict scenes in paintings while concise words are used to describe scenes and events in poems, making for a beautiful yet enigmatic art style. Such an art style requires viewers to patiently examine the details and attempt to understand the meaning, which creates a barrier for a wide audience to relish and disseminate it. The condition can be effectively improved with immersive and interactive animation techniques. In this paper, we present the design and production of an interactive 3D animation entitled "Illustrating Ten Poems" based on the famous Chinese painting with the same name. Compared with viewing the original painting, the animation provides immersive scene reconstruction in Chinese painting style, interactive characters and visual-audio experience. Rather than complete three-dimensional reconstruction, we attempted some innovative methods which proved to be effective and efficient in Chinese painting style artwork production.
